LIN 490 - Introduction to Language Research


An introduction to basic aspects of the experimental study of human linguistic abilities. These aspects will include discussion of research questions, research design (sampling, validity, reliability), task choice, data handling, analysis and interpretation, and reporting conventions. Where relevant, students also will be introduced to computer resources used in Linguistics.

Prerequisite(s): LIN 313  and two other LIN courses in the 310-317 range (one of which may be taken concurrently), or permission of instructor; MAT 120  or PSY 201  or equivalent.
